Survey
description
Mortality public-use data by underlying cause of death include all deaths
occurring within the United States. Beginning in 1994, the same detail is
available as separate data sets in the public-use file for Puerto Rico,
the Virgin Islands, and Guam. Deaths of U.S. citizens and deaths of
members of the Armed Forces occurring outside the United States are not
included.
Data
file description
Data are obtained from certificates filed for deaths occurring in each
State. Data were obtained from all certificates for 1968-71 and 1973-97
and from a 50-percent sample of certificates for 1972. Causes of death for
1968-78 were coded according to the Eighth Revision, International
Classification of Diseases, Adapted for Use in the United States. Causes
of death for 1979-96 were coded according to the International
Classification of Diseases, Ninth Revision.
Three underlying
cause-of-death data tape files are available for each year 1968 through
1988. The detailed files for these data years, except for 1972, include
one tape record for each death that occurred. For 1972, the file includes
one tape record for each death in the 50-percent sample. Death certificate
numbers are not on the tapes. Data on the local-area summary files
and the cause-of-death summary files have been weighted and represent a
total count of deaths.
One data tape file is
available for each year 1989 through 1997 from NTIS. The detailed file
format is for a single calendar year and includes data for cities,
counties, and metropolitan areas with a population of 100,000 or more. The
day of death, date of birth of decedent, and the death certificate numbers
are excluded from this file. NCHS does not distribute certificates, files,

Geographic
coverage
Place of death is classified by State and county. In residence
classification, all deaths are allocated to the usual place of residence
as reported on the death certificate and are classified by State, county,
and city.
For data
years 1968-78, cities of 250,000 persons or more are classified. Beginning
with 1979, cities of 100,000 persons or more are classified.

Customized data
tapes
Additional tapes for 1989-97 are sold directly by NCHS to researchers
whose needs for data cannot be met by the public-use data file sold
through NTIS. Requests for tapes with more detail must be in writing and
mailed to:
Director, Division of
Vital Statistics
National Center for Health Statistics
3311 Toledo Road, Floor 7
Hyattsville, Maryland 20782
All requests for
additional data should include a list of the specific data items that are
needed and an explanation of how the tapes will be used. The Director will
make a determination on the request and release data tapes as applicable.
However, recipients must agree to additional restrictions to avoid
possible inadvertent disclosure of confidential information.
